Pumpkin Classification

Convolutional Neural Networks (CNNs) have emerged as a powerful technique for image recognition tasks, and pumpkin classification is no exception. These networks leverage recursive layers to extract geometric features from images, enabling them to precisely distinguish between different gourd varieties.

A typical CNN-based pumpkin classification system involves several stages: image preprocessing, feature extraction, and classification.

Initially. This may involve techniques such as resizing, normalization, and data augmentation. Subsequently, the CNN architecture extracts a set of relevant features from the preprocessed images. These features capture the characteristic patterns that distinguish different pumpkin varieties. Finally, a fully connected classifier maps the extracted features to the corresponding class labels, producing the final classification result.

Several CNN architectures have been effectively applied to pumpkin classification tasks, including AlexNet, VGGNet, and ResNet. The choice of architecture depends on factors such as the size and complexity of the dataset, as well as the desired level of accuracy.

Estimating Pumpkin Yield Using Time Series Analysis

Successfully harvesting pumpkins relies on precise yield estimates. Time series analysis offers a powerful approach for estimating pumpkin yield by studying historical information. This demands identifying patterns in past yields to predict future results. By incorporating factors like climate, cultivation dates, and ground conditions, time series models can generate valuable knowledge for pumpkin producers to optimize their operations.
